GLYCERYL TRIACETATE [1 record]

Record 1 2004-03-10

English

Subject field(s)
  • Chemical Elements and Compounds
  • Food Additives
DEF

An oily, colorless and bitter liquid, the acetic triester of glycerol, [used as a] flavoring [agent] for ice cream, beverages, confectionery and candy.
